**Management Meeting Minutes — Tillbrook Franchise Agreement**

Attendees: R. Mancaster, J. Odell, S. Ferreno.

Quick recap for the incoming director: we agreed in principle to grant Tillbrook Ventures the northern territory franchise, pending their training commitments. Royalty stays at 6%, marketing levy at 2%. Jonas will redraft clause 9 on supply exclusivity. Everyone felt the timeline is tight but workable. For the bigger picture on why we're doing this, see the note below.

board note of kageg-bahof: The renewal with Holwynax Holdings closes at $2 million a year, 5 percent below the last contract. Project Ulaath slips by two quarters because of the supplier delay.

Vendor note: the translation-string extraction script (lexpull.py) is maintained by Quillgate Localization, not by us. We only pin versions; do not patch it in-repo. Breakages usually mean Quillgate changed their catalog schema — check their changelog before filing anything. Contract renews annually through the Polyglot procurement track. If the script misbehaves or you need schema docs, reach their integration desk at the address below.

alerts address for yajof-kahog: eliax@qirvanlabs.corp

Two custodians must be present; verify both against the custodian roster before proceeding. Generate the keypair on the air-gapped laptop, confirm the fingerprint aloud, and record it in the ceremony log. Seal the hardware token in the tamper-evident bag. Before sealing, the token must be initialized with the recovery passphrase written directly below.

recovery phrase for tawef-bawef: ralath-jorius-casok-julok

Subject: Handover — Scrubwell retention sweeper

Hey Tomas,

Before I head out, a few notes on the Scrubwell sweeper. It runs nightly at 02:15 and deletes anything in `events_raw` older than 400 days, in batches of 5k so the replicas don't fall behind. If it stalls, check the advisory lock first — nine times out of ten a stuck batch is holding it. Logs land in the ops bucket. It connects to the archive cluster with the string below.

replica DSN, kajep-yahag: mssql://praok_svc:iF@db-8d68.plorvaio.local:5432/eliion